A platter holds 24 strawberries, 2 apples, and 16 are oranges. What fraction of all the fruit are strawberries? What fraction are apples? What fraction are oranges?

Answers

Answer:

strawberries are 24/42 apples are 2/42 and oranges are 16/42

Step-by-step explanation:

Trust me i did these same exact problems!!!

Also mark me brainly if this helped!!! :)

The fraction for strawberries is 12/21, the fraction for apples is 1/21, and the fraction for oranges is 8/21.

What is a fraction?

Fraction number consists of two parts, one is the top of the fraction number which is called the numerator and the second is the bottom of the fraction number which is called the denominator.

It is given that:

A platter holds 24 strawberries, 2 apples, and 16 are oranges.

The total number of fruits = 24 + 2 + 16

The total number of fruits = 42

The fraction for strawberries = 24/42 = 12/21

The fraction for apples  = 2/42 = 1/21

The fraction for oranges = 16/42 = 8/21

Thus, the fraction for strawberries is 12/21, the fraction for apples is 1/21, and the fraction for oranges is 8/21.

find the value of K so that the line through the points (4,-3) and(k,7) is parallel to the line with the equation 4x+6y=10

Answers

Answer:

-8

Step-by-step explanation:

Convert the equation from standard form into slope-intercept form by....

Moving the variable to the right-hand side and change its sign: 6y = 10 - 4xDivide both sides of the equation by 6 : y= [tex]\frac{5}{3}[/tex]-[tex]\frac{2}{3}[/tex]xUse the commutavie property to reoder the terms : y= -[tex]\frac{2}{3}[/tex]x + [tex]\frac{5}{3}[/tex]

(Parallel lines have the same slope.. so the slope = -[tex]\frac{2}{3}[/tex])

Create and equation using the slope and the point (k,7)

Make the equation : 7 = -[tex]\frac{2}{3}[/tex](k) + [tex]\frac{5}{3}[/tex]Multiply both sides of the equation by 3 : 21 = -2k + 5Move the varable to the left-hand side and change its sign: 2k + 21 = 5Move the constant to the right-hand side and change its sign: 2k + 5 - 21Calculate the difference: 2k = -16Divide both sides of the equation by 2 : k= -8

Solution :  k = -8
